Transaction 38abea8918a2254146b41edaf3b77f3fc8ef2c05c2c99d7428f2a0cb1ff1a43f

1 Input
2 Outputs
  • 38abea8918a2254146b41edaf3b77f3fc8ef2c05c2c99d7428f2a0cb1ff1a43f:0
  • value  84380
    address  39yUdCZr1QFbGAke958AepngjAbzbVGhjA
  • 38abea8918a2254146b41edaf3b77f3fc8ef2c05c2c99d7428f2a0cb1ff1a43f:1
  • value  80153
    address  3EKNXo3yw9CZCQrneeAcf1gwKGTCKRN4cB